TL;DR Summary

Universal Music Group is threatening to remove its song catalog from TikTok as the companies have failed to reach an agreement on issues such as artist compensation and AI. In a scathing open letter, UMG accused TikTok of attempting to bully and intimidate them into accepting a deal worth less than fair market value. TikTok, in response, accused UMG of prioritizing greed over the interests of their artists and songwriters. The dispute also involves concerns about AI-generated music flooding the platform. If an agreement is not reached, UMG's songs will be removed from TikTok once the current deal expires.
